微信小程序开发中的视频播放和直播功能可以通过使用小程序提供的API和组件来实现。在本文中,将以实际代码案例的形式详细介绍如何实现视频播放和直播功能。
一、视频播放功能的实现
- 在小程序页面中引入video组件,并设置相关属性,例如src、controls等。
<video src="{
{videoSrc}}" controls></video>
- 在小程序页面的js文件中定义videoSrc变量,并设置视频源。
Page({
data: {
videoSrc: 'https://example.com/video.mp4'
}
})
- 在小程序页面的js文件中可以通过监听video的相关事件来实现控制视频播放的功能,例如播放、暂停等。
Page({
data: {
videoSrc: 'https://example.com/video.mp4'
},
onPlay() {
const videoContext = wx.createVideoContext('myVideo');
videoContext.play();
},
onPause() {
const videoContext = wx.createVideoContext('myVideo');
videoContext.pause();
}
})
二、直播功能的实现
- 在小程序页面中引